What are the hours like in entertainment law? Looking into switching gears if I accept this new role with DLA Piper

If you're in BigLaw, it's no different than any other practice area.

DLA does a lot of film financing and big-dollar deals, far less talent-related stuff. So don't expect too much of a change from what you might be doing now, just a different flavor.
